European Real-World Registry for Use of the Ion Endoluminal System
NCT06923774 · Status: RECRUITING · Type: OBSERVATIONAL · Enrollment: 1200
Last updated 2026-03-24
Summary
The objective of this study is to collect collect real-world data for the Ion endoluminal system.
Conditions
- Pulmonary Nodule
- Lung Cancer
Interventions
- DEVICE
-
Ion endoluminal system
Lung nodule biopsy and/or localization procedure using the Ion endoluminal system per sites' standard of care
